Quality Control Rapper Wavy Navy Pooh Killed In A Drive-By Shooting

Wavy Navy Pooh was killed in a drive-by shooting outside Miami. The Rapper was in his car at a red light and another car pulled over and pulled the trigger. According to the Associated Press. Two children, ages 5 and 1, and a woman were also riding in the Toyota Camry but were not injured.
In the front seat, there was a one-year-old child in a car seat that easily could have been struck by gunfire and taken his life,” said Alvaro Zabaleta, a Miami-Dade Police Department rep.
Wavy Navy Pooh was signed to Quality Control Music where he released his 2020 debut Murder Is a Major Issue and 2021’s Endangered.
